我可以在 Firefox 中恢复之前的会话吗?

Tim*_*Tim 5 firefox

我在 Ubuntu 16.04 上的 Firefox 59.0.2(64 位)中打开了大约 200 个网页标签。

我关闭了 Firefox,然后重新启动了 Ubuntu。

当我再次启动 Firefox 时,我有机会通过单击历史记录->恢复以前的会话来恢复以前的 200 个网页标签。但是我没有这样做,而是单击了一个新标签并打开了一个新页面,然后关闭了该标签,这出乎我的意料地关闭了 Firefox(在 Chrome 浏览器中,关闭唯一的标签并没有关闭 Chrome 浏览器)。

现在点击 History->Restore Previous Session 只恢复网页的单个标签。有什么方法可以恢复上一届 200 个网页标签的会话吗?

请注意,在我看来很难从 Firefox 的最近历史中找出前 200 个网页的 URL。上一个200个标签页的上一个会话也是通过点击历史->恢复上一个会话创建的,我恢复的时候Firefox并没有真正打开所有的200个网页,而是当我真正点击它的标签时打开每个网页,我没有点击所有 200 个标签。

小智 7

抱歉回复晚了,我刚刚在 Firefox 78 上遇到了同样的问题:我在 Firefox 仍在启动时错误地关闭了它,并且我所有 200 多个打开的选项卡都消失了:(

我将正确的过程粘贴到此处以供将来参考,但所有功劳均归于 Ghacks 的 Martin Brinkmann:如果会话恢复无法正常工作,如何恢复 Firefox 会话

我按照以下步骤解决了:

  1. 关闭火狐浏览器。确保没有浏览器实例正在运行。
  2. 打开配置文件文件夹并将当前会话文件sessionstore.jsonlz4重命名为sessionstore-backup.jsonlz4
  3. 打开配置文件的sessionstore-backups文件夹。
  4. 将recovery.jsonlz4重命名为recovery-backup.jsonlz4
  5. 将recovery.backlz4重命名为recovery-backup.backlz4
  6. 复制要恢复的会话恢复备份,例如previous.jsonlz4
  7. 返回 Firefox 配置文件的根目录。
  8. 将复制的文件粘贴到根文件夹。
  9. 将其重命名为sessionstore.jsonlz4
  10. 重新启动火狐浏览器。
  11. Firefox 可能会自动接收会话。如果没有,请按键盘上的 Alt 键,然后选择“历史记录”>“恢复上一个会话”。


DrM*_*pik 3

为了避免点击 200 个快捷方式:

  • 单击CtrlShiftH可查看完整的历史记录。
  • 使用 -click 选择一系列 URL Shift,或使用 -click 一次选择一个项目Ctrl
  • 右键单击一个项目并选择Open all in tabs

Firefox 库对话框

为了便于将来参考,您可以标记书签,以便更轻松地搜索和加载批次。

  • 如果一个选项卡只是在那里呆了几周(未查看/未单击),我认为它不会每天都被放入历史记录中,所以可能需要进行一些挖掘,但至少它们应该都在那里,一些*时间* (2认同)